Shawn’s journey in gymnastics began at just three years old. Coached by Liang Chow, she quickly developed a unique combination of extreme power and rock-solid consistency. Her transition into the senior elite tier in 2007 is widely considered one of the greatest rookie seasons in gymnastics history. That single year, she completely dominated the sport by winning the all-around titles at the American Cup, the Pan American Games, the U.S. National Championships, and the World Championships.
The defining moment of her athletic career came at the 2008 Beijing Olympic Games. At just 16 years old, Shawn handled immense pressure to take home four Olympic medals:
- Gold Medal: Balance Beam
- Silver Medal: Individual All-Around, Floor Exercise, Women's Team Competition

Life After Gymnastics
After hanging up her leotard, Shawn proved her competitive drive translates seamlessly to the screen. She quickly pivot to entertainment, showcasing her versatility to a whole new audience:
- Dancing With The Stars: In 2009, Shawn traded her gymnastics grips for ballroom shoes, winning the Mirrorball Trophy in Season 8. She later returned for the All-Stars edition in 2012, finishing as the runner-up.
- Reality TV & Ventures: She brought her grit to high-stakes shows like NBC's The Apprentice and CNBC's Adventure Capitalists.
- Special Forces: World's Toughest Test: Proving she remains as tough as ever, Shawn conquered the grueling military style challenges on Fox's reality competition series, outlasting almost the entire cast to successfully complete the finale.
